From a business perspective, Grace Church operates as an incorporated non profit charity known as the Parish of Grace Church, Markham, the officers of which are the Incumbent and the two Churchwardens. The Churchwardens are ably assisted by three Deputy Churchwardens.

Much of the successful operation of Grace Church is to a large extent the result of the devotion, skills, and abilities of its numerous volunteers.

Grace Church offers a cross section of interesting activities for all parishioners and all are encouraged to get involved in a Christian ministry in an area suiting their interest, particularly if new to the community worshiping at Grace Church, for there is an array of choices:
